Requirements
- Positive, friendly, courteous, and kind attitude with great customer service skills.
- Master knowledge of troubleshooting HVAC issues such as basic low voltage, refrigerant, communicating equipment faults, and airflow.
- A proven history of quality troubleshooting with 15 or more years of experience at an HVAC company.
- The position requires someone with 10 yrs of experience repairing or replacing residential HVAC systems.
- Clear understanding of duct work, zoning, and communicating systems.
- Evaluate overall system installations and identify any code-related, safety, or comfort issues.
- Be able to repair issues on the job the same day to ensure customer satisfaction and comfort.
- Coordinate with Install Supervisors, Install crews, and management.
- Be able to coach or train others.
- Residency within 35 miles of our Kennesaw office.
- Be willing to work occasional Saturdays.
- Be willing to attend training and classes.
- Experience with a smart device and technical ability. Service Titan experience is a plus!
- Excellent professional & personal references.
- Ability to pass a background, MVR, and drug screening, and to maintain a drug-free lifestyle.
- Physical ability to lift over 70 lbs and climb up and down a ladder on a regular basis. Standing for long periods of time, extensive kneeling, squatting, and stooping.
